Blackberry Q20 Linux [better]
Title: Bringing Linux to the BlackBerry Q20 (Classic) – A Modern Twist on a Legendary Keyboard
Blackberry Q20 + Linux: A Surprisingly Functional Combo
The Blackberry Q20 (Classic) runs Blackberry 10 OS — a QNX-based system, not Android or iOS. While BB10 is deprecated, its core is UNIX-like, making it oddly compatible with Linux workflows. blackberry q20 linux
The BlackBerry Classic (Q20) is an iconic piece of hardware from 2014 that has found a second life among enthusiasts as a "distraction-free" mobile Linux terminal. While it was never designed to run anything but BlackBerry 10 (BB10), its physical keyboard and compact form factor make it a unique target for modern experimentation. Hardware Overview Title: Bringing Linux to the BlackBerry Q20 (Classic)
7. Recommended Linux Tools
| Tool | Purpose |
|------|---------|
| bbtools | Sideload APKs, reboot device, backup |
| mtp-tools / mtp-detect | File access |
| syncevolution | Bluetooth OBEX sync (contacts/calendar) |
| barry (deprecated) | Old BlackBerry OS, not BB10 – avoid |
| scrcpy | Doesn't work – not an Android device | While it was never designed to run anything
Getting the cellular radio to talk to a standard Linux stack is a massive hurdle. 3. Architecture
Security Root of Trust: The boot sequence checks for digital signatures at every stage, from the initial hardware boot to the loading of BlackBerry OS 10.